The Infrastructure Play: From Camper Setup to Business Stack
When we look past the canned goods and the Murphy bed, we see a core principle: diversification and self-sufficiency. This isn't just about survivalism; it’s about business architecture. A successful founder, whether they're running an agency, an e-commerce drop-shipping operation, or a high-ticket consulting service, needs their 'camper' to be portable, robust, and independent of the main grid.
Think about your current marketing funnel. Is it built on rented land? If your primary lead magnet relies on a platform's email service, and your payment processing relies on a single gateway, you are living in a state of perpetual operational risk. The moment they change the Terms of Service, your entire cash flow—your EBITDA—is at risk.

Actionable Steps for the Founder
If you're a founder currently relying heavily on one or two major platforms for your MRR, it’s time for a system audit. Don't just optimize your copywriting; optimize your *exit strategy* from the platform.
- Audit Dependency: List every single point of failure in your current sales funnel. Where is the single point of failure that, if removed, stops revenue?
- Diversify Distribution: Don't just rely on paid ads. Build owned channels—the newsletter list that lives *off* the platform, the community forum, the proprietary content stack.
